胶束电动毛细管色谱法测定水飞蓟素及其制剂中主要有效成分含量

摘    要:目的 建立一种胶束电动毛细管色谱分离测定水飞蓟素及其制剂Legalon胶囊、益肝灵片中水飞蓟宾、异水飞蓟宾、水飞蓟亭、水飞蓟宁含量的方法。方法 选用缓冲液为30 mmol.L-1硼砂-50 mmol.L-1去氧牛磺胆酸-20 mmol.L-1 β-环糊精,pH为9.2,运行电压20 kV,压差进样,进样时间3 s,检测波长为288 nm,温度为室温。内标为芦丁。结果 样品中各组分的平均回收率分别为水飞蓟亭99.9%,水飞蓟宁98.3%,水飞蓟宾99.0%,异水飞蓟宾98.2%。结论 此法准确、灵敏,且能分离水飞蓟宾、异水飞蓟宾的非对映异构体。

SEPARATION AND DETERMINATION OF EFFECTIVE COMPONENTS IN SILYMARIN AND PREPARATIONS OF SILYMARIN BY MECC

Abstract:AIM: To develop a micellar electrokinetic capillary chromatographic (MECC) method for the separation and determination of silybin, isosilybin, silydianin and silycristin in Legalon capsules, Yiganling tablets and silymarin. METHODS: A buffer solution containing 30 mmol.L-1 disodium tetraborate, 50 mmol.L-1 taurodeoxycholic acid sodium salt and 20 mmol.L-1 beta-cyclodextrin (pH 9.2) was found to be the most suitable electrolyte for this separation. The applied voltage was 20 kV and UV detection wavelength was 288 nm. Rutin was used as internal standard. RESULTS: The average recoveries of 99.9% for silycristin, 98.3% for silydianin, 99.0% for silybin and 98.2% for isosilybin were obtained. CONCLUSION: The method is sensitive and accurate for the analysis of diasteroisomers of silybin and isosilybin.
